Shooting of Salman Khan's most ambitious project 'Radhe: Your Most Wanted Bhai' concludes

After much delays, the remaining portions of  Salman Khan, Disha Patani, Jackie Shroff and Randeep Hooda starrer, 'Radhe: Your Most Wanted Bhai' has been completed. The team posted the video on their official social media account. In the video, Salman can be seen exiting from a car on the sets and announcing, “it’s a wrap for ‘Radhe’.” The superstar can be seen sporting a checkered shirt and jeans. In the video, Salman looks absolutely happy as the team wraps up the shoot. The video ends with the text 'Coming Soon'

Disha and Salman were shooting a song in Aamby Valley, Lonavala. The team later shot at Mumbai’s studio where they completed the remaining patchwork. The 15-20 days film schedule was to go on till the month-end, but the film has wrapped up well ahead of the schedule. The film  was slated to hit the theatres on Eid this year but was stalled due to the coronavirus pandemic. Earlier, Salman Khan shared a photo of himself from the sets of Radhe: Your Most Wanted Bhai as he resumed shooting after more than six months. In the photo, Salman Khan is seen with his back towards the camera. He is walking on a road, while a few bikes and people with helmets can be seen in the background. Dabang Khan is dressed in a quirky leather jacket with a pair of black trousers. The shooting of Radhe: Your Most Wanted Bhai began in November last year.
